Kraken opens UK’s first EnTech superhub in Manchester

Kraken launches the UK’s first energy tech superhub in Manchester in a move to turbocharge the green energy revolution in the UK. The cutting-edge ‘Kraken Tech Centre’ will house engineering teams and work as a testing hub for integrating third-party devices with Kraken – the world’s fastest-growing energy platform. Kraken connects the entire energy value chain and is the technology behind many global energy giants, including Octopus Energy, Tokyo Gas, Origin Energy and E.ON. TAQA and Octopus Energy Group’s Kraken team up to drive decarbonisation in the Middle East and Eurasia

Next generation energy technology provider Kraken Technologies is teaming up with Abu Dhabi National Energy Company PSJC (TAQA), one of the largest listed integrated utilities in Europe, the Middle East and Africa to launch a pilot project to trial the Kraken platform with TAQA’s power and water customers in the UAE. This program supports TAQA’s focus on operational excellence, optimisation and digitalisation across the value chain to improve customer services as well as exemplifying a high-performing and efficient transmission and distribution business.  The companies are also exploring a joint venture…

Maritime Charity Predicts It Would Take 16,741,178 Years To Remove All The Plastic From The Ocean

Leading marine conservation charity PADI AWARE estimates it would take 16,741,178 years for its divers working at current capacity to remove every plastic item from the world’s oceans – the equivalent of over six ice ages. The staggering fact has been revealed as the charity partners with Kraken Rum to help raise awareness of the impact of litter on the oceans and help fund the organisation’s vital work, launching the ultimate in gelato protest glamour, The Kraken ‘Ice Clean’.
